This study investigates the elastic stiffness constants, elastic moduli and eigen values of the stiffness matrix of nematic liquid crystalline compounds 4,4'-di-3-alkyl azoxybenzene and 4,4'-di-4-alkyl azoxybenzene using two different computational processes, viz.,General Utility Lattice Program (GULP) and the ELATE Program from reported experimental data of cell parameters. The study also attempts to predict the liquid crystal structure in terms of elastic constants. Elastic constats determine the thermal stability, stiffness and degree of molecular order, which determines the range of temperature of the liquid crystalline phase. This study included the comparison of different physical parameters of the above compounds and also made an attempt to understand the reason why 4,4'-di-3-alkyl azoxybenzene exhibits the mesophase for a wider range of temperature(42°C)than smaller mesophase range of temperature(9°C)in 4,4'-di-4-alkyl azoxybenzene. The two dimensional representation of the variation of elastic moduli of the above compounds, which explore the stability of crystals are also discussed. The study revealed that the elastic stiffness constants, elastic moduli, anisotropy of elastic moduli and eigen values of the stiffness matrix of liquid crystalline compound 4,4'-di-3-alkyl azoxybenzene are more than those of 4,4'-di-4-alkyl azoxybenzene. The two dimensional variation of Young’s modulus, shear modulus and Poisson’s ratio in xy-plane, xz-plane and yz-plane is more in 4,4'-di-3-alkyl azoxybenzene compared tothat in 4,4'-di-4-alkyl azoxybenzene. Interestingly, the linear compressibility of compound 4,4'-di-4-alkyl azoxybenzene in xy-plane ,xz-plane and yz-plane is more compared to linear compressibility of compound 4,4'-di-3-alkyl azoxybenzene. The higher value of elastic moduli and eigenvalues of the stiffness matrix in 4,4'-di-3-alkyl azoxybenzene indicates that the intermolecular force is stronger and resists reorientation more, which may stabilize the nematic phase for a wider range of temperature(temperature range of 42°C) compared to that in 4,4'-di-4-alkyl azoxybenzene (temperature range of 9°C). Poisson’s ratio of 4,4'-di-3-alkyl azoxybenzene is negative, which specifically for display devices, can contribute to improved flexibility, responsiveness and better display.
